Job summary
Finegreen are currently supporting a large NHS organisation in the appointment of a senior Facilities Management (FM) professional. Holding responsibility for the operational delivery of comprehensive, high-quality, cost effective Facilities Services to a number of sites within the locality.Key responsibilities will include:
Lead a team of in-house operational staff and undertaking the procurement, management and monitoring of external contracts within the Trust and associated community services, ensuring all performance targets are met, including Healthcare and Care Quality standards, whilst striving for improvement across the Directorate;
Produce reports, make recommendations; work with/lead/chair meetings with clinical and non-clinical representatives regarding national and local initiatives which contribute to the Trust improving services to patients, staff and visitors;
Responsibility of implementing national and local initiatives in relation to Facilities Services and provide feedback in support of a coordinated approach to the collation of information in relation to Trust returns, Board Papers and audit reports;
Specialist knowledge over multiple disciplines to lead a multi-faceted Facilities department, managing in house services for the Trust and associated services and facilities contracts;
Ability to lead multiple priorities and conflicting demands in a pressurised and dynamic environment;
Meet demands and deadlines, ensuring achievement of key performance indicators, balance scorecards and assessment of the Trusts performance e.g., Care Quality Commission Standards,
PLACE, Cleanliness, Infection Prevention and Control, Nutritional Standards, HACCP, Health and
Safety etc.;
Ensure the provision of cost-effective Facilities Services in accordance with any SLAs or contract documentation, where appropriate including all necessary service enhancements and the delivery of required cost efficiency savings.
The ideal candidate will have:
Management experienced with analytical insight, with an influential and diplomatic approach to leadership;
Degree level qualification in relevant field or demonstrable significant equivalent experience;
Experience within Facilities Services at a senior management level, working within an NHS/healthcare setting;
